Some community details (provided by our in-country partners)

Sudara is home to more than 1,300 people including women and children who battle constantly to survive. The majority of the people here are farmers who can barely harvest enough food to meet their family needs. They are confronted daily with the need for food, shelter, clothing and clean water. The most accessible sources of water are hand-dug wells, which are usually only 10-15 feet deep and are never sealed, therefore a very high risk of being contaminated. The people have battled a long time with all sorts of infectious diseases.

A drilled well has been provided here giving relief to this community of people.

Well Details

Project Completed: 2016-11-28 Well Depth: 100 ft.
Depth of Water: 32.00 ft. Casing Diameter: 4.00 in.
Screen Length: 30.00 ft. Developed By: Surge Bailing
Development Time: 3.00 hrs. Well Yield: 7.00 gpm
Disinfection: 25.00 hrs. Handpump: Afridev
Water Colour: Clear Water Odour: None
Turbidity: Clear Taste: Good
Nitrate: Bacti Test: Negative
Iron: pH: 7.000
